Drafts

A drafty front door can make your home uncomfortable, cost you more money, and reduce your home's efficiency in terms of energy. But there are ways to fix it. First, you have to identify the source of the issue. is.

Weatherstripping is a common culprit. If the stripping has been damaged, it can let drafts into your home. Another reason is the gap between your slab and the door frame.

One of the most effective ways to protect a door from drafts is to install new weather stripping. It's simple and [original] inexpensive. It is available at any hardware store.

If you're looking for a permanent solution, you could raise the threshold of your doorway. This will help prevent drafts and condensation.

There are other ways to stop air from entering with the use of a door sweep. The proper size sweep can make a significant difference.

Wrapping a draft snake around the bottom of a door is another method of sealing it. This is a low-cost and efficient alternative to installing door sweeps.

Another method to determine if your door has drafts is to use a flame test. You'll need a match or lighter. Move the light across the crease of your door frame to see if it flickers. This is the best way to determine if there's a draft.

In the end, you can use a highly-sticky foam tape to stop any drafts that could be leaking out. Although the product is not the most beautiful of solutions however, it is affordable and will spare you a lot of headaches over the long term.

Squeaky hinges

It can be quite frustrating when your door hinges rattle. It is possible to fix the problem but there are a few steps you should take to get your hinges back in good working order.

Clean the hinges first. This will eliminate dirt and dust that can cause the squeaking. If you're having difficulty getting your hinges to move smooth and smoothly, you could try applying lubrication. Lubricating the hinges can make them more efficient and prevent recurring noises.

Spray lubricants can be very efficient. However, you need to apply the lubricant liberally. If you don't apply it right, you could end with spreading the lubricant all over your hinges.

Another option is to use petroleum jelly for lubrication of the hinges. Petroleum jelly is a liquid which sticks well to hinges. Petroleum jelly can be rubbed on the hinges using either a Q-tip or cotton ball. After the hinges have been lubricated, you can then hammer them into place.
